Output dc6318efdc9d4c924f4385bba1cd2c1c98946b9bbfe6c8038ae20821480e69ec:1

value
20439894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 508dd52125a00b6781878e196528a26739e7ae14 OP_EQUAL
address
392wtb32KVUV5T3yxvBD725btxZDsKiHe1
transaction
dc6318efdc9d4c924f4385bba1cd2c1c98946b9bbfe6c8038ae20821480e69ec
spent
true